2023 Women’s World Cup: Portugal vs. Vietnam odds, picks and predictions

Analyzing Thursday’s Portugal vs. Vietnam odds and lines, with Women’s World Cup soccer expert picks, predictions and best bets.

In a Group E matchup, Portugal (0-0-1 / W-D-L) and Vietnam (0-0-1) meet Thursday in the 2023 Women’s World Cup at FMG Stadium Waikato in Hamilton, New Zealand. Kickoff is scheduled for 3:30 a.m. ET (FS1). Below, we analyze BetMGM Sportsbook’s lines around the Portugal vs. Vietnam odds, and make our best Women’s World Cup bets, picks and predictions.

Portugal suffered a 1-0 defeat in the opening match against Netherland, while the Dutch outshot it 12-3. Midfielder Fatima Pinto, not to be confused with the singer of the same name, managed just 1 shot in the opening contest.

Vietnam was held without a shot against the USWNT, falling 3-0 in the opening match. It’s not much of a shock, as Vietnam was outscored 20-3 during matches in 2022 against teams in this year’s World Cup, while getting outscored 18-2 in 2023 in matches leading up to the tournament by fellow World Cup opponents.

2023 Women’s World Cup: Australia vs. Nigeria odds, picks and predictions

Analyzing Thursday’s Australia vs. Nigeria odds and lines, with Women’s World Cup soccer expert picks, predictions and best bets.

Australia (1 win, 0 draws, 0 losses) battles Nigeria (0-1-0) in the 2nd match for each Group B side. Kickoff Thursday from Suncorp Stadium is set for 6 a.m. ET (FS1). Below, we analyze BetMGM Sportsbook’s lines around the Australia vs. Nigeria odds, and make our best Women’s World Cup bets, picks and predictions.

Australia, without arguably the best player in the tournament, F Sam Kerr (calf injury), beat Ireland 1-0 Thursday. It had 4 more shots and 1 more shot on target. The winning goal was a 52nd-minute penalty kick by D Stephanie Catley. Australia did control most of the match, holding possession for 63%. It sits 10th in the FIFA Women’s World Rankings.

Nigeria, which ranks 40th and is the lowest-ranked Group B side, drew Canada 0-0 Thursday despite being significantly outplayed on most fronts. It had 5 fewer shots, 2 fewer shots on goal and possession for a mere 33% of the match. Nigeria will also be without starting M Deborah Abiodun, who received a red card in the 98th minute of the opener.

2023 Women’s World Cup: USA vs. Netherlands odds, picks and predictions

Analyzing Wednesday’s USA vs. Netherlands odds and lines, with Women’s World Cup soccer expert picks, predictions and best bets.

USA (1 win, 0 losses, 0 draws) battles Netherlands (1-0-0) in the 2nd match for each Group E nation. Kickoff from Wellington Regional Stadium is set for 9 p.m. ET Wednesday (FOX).  Below, we analyze BetMGM Sportsbook’s lines around the USA vs. Netherlands odds, and make our best Women’s World Cup bets, picks and predictions.

The USWNT, the favorite to win the World Cup, won its 1st match against Vietnam 3-0 with 28 shots and 7 on target. Vietnam didn’t have a single shot. However, USA didn’t cover the 5.5-goal spread and wasn’t able to dominate as expected. USA is No. 1 in the FIFA Women’s World Rankings.

No. 9 Netherlands should pose a far greater challenge. It beat Portugal 1-0 Sunday via a 13th-minute goal from D Stefanie van der Gragt. Netherlands had 12 shot and 5 on target; Portugal had 2 shots and 1 on target. The Dutch are led by 30-year-old F Lieke Martens, who had 145 caps and 59 goals as of July 2.

2023 Women’s World Cup: Spain vs. Zambia odds, picks and predictions

Analyzing Wednesday’s Spain vs. Zambia odds and lines, with Women’s World Cup soccer expert picks, predictions and best bets.

Spain (1-0-0 / W-D-L) takes on Zambia (0-0-1) Wednesday as Group C play continues. Kickoff from Eden Park is at 3:30 a.m. ET (FS1). Below, we analyze FanDuel Sportsbook’s lines around the Spain vs. Zambia odds, and make our best Women’s World Cup bets, picks and predictions.

The results in the opening games for both these teams were not surprising. Zambia was +775 to beat Japan and lost 5-0. Spain was -10000 against Costa Rica and won 3-0. But sometimes it’s how you play that matters.

Zambia made its World Cup debut against Japan Saturday and was overpowered by the 2015 runner-up. It wasn’t immediate though as Japan only led 1-0 at halftime on a goal from M Hinata Miyazawa in the 43rd minute.

Japan’s defense prevented the African nation from any offensive success. Zambia failed to take a shot on goal, or any shot close to the goal, even with its lone corner kick.

Spain’s 3-0 win against Costa Rica, while impressive, was still much lower than what its stats show. Spain took 22 corner kicks and 46 shots against Costa Rica (12 on goal). It held the ball 80% of the time, while Costa Rica failed to take a single shot on goal.

Despite all that, Spain only scored twice, on goals by M Aitana Bonmati and F Esther Gonzalez — 1 of Spain’s goals was a Costa Rica own goal.

Spain is No. 6 in the FIFA Women’s World Rankings; Zambia checks in at No. 77.

2023 Women’s World Cup: Japan vs. Costa Rica odds, picks and predictions

Analyzing Wednesday’s Japan vs. Costa Rica odds and lines, with Women’s World Cup soccer expert picks, predictions and best bets.

In a Group C matchup, Japan (1-0-0 / W-D-L) and Costa Rica (0-0-1) meet Wednesday in the 2023 Women’s World Cup at Forsyth Barr Stadium in Dunedin, New Zealand. Kickoff is scheduled for 1 a.m. ET (FS1). Below, we analyze BetMGM Sportsbook’s lines around the Japan vs. Costa Rica odds, and make our best Women’s World Cup bets, picks and predictions.

Japan rolled to a 5-0 victory against Zambia in the team’s opening match, as Hinata Miyazawa hit the back of the net twice, while Jun Endo, Mina Tanaka and Riko Ueki each contributed goals.

Costa Rica was on the short end of a 3-0 score against group favorite Spain. CRC had a difficult time in the possession game, with Spain winning the battle 80% to 20%, and Spain had 22 corner kicks to just 1. In addition, Costa Rica failed to get a shot on goal, while Spain racked up 12.

2023 Women’s World Cup: Canada vs. Ireland odds, picks and predictions

Analyzing Wednesday’s Canada vs. Ireland odds and lines, with Women’s World Cup soccer expert picks, predictions and best bets.

Canada (0 wins, 1 draw, 0 losses) battles Ireland (0-0-1) Wednesday in each nation’s 2nd 2023 Women’s World Cup group stage match. Kickoff from Perth Rectangular Stadium in Australia is set for 8 a.m. ET (FS1). Below, we analyze BetMGM Sportsbook’s lines around the Canada vs. Ireland odds, and make our best Women’s World Cup bets, picks and predictions.

Canada drew Nigeria 0-0 Thursday despite having 68% of the possession, 5 more shots and 2 more shots on target. Canada also 10 less fouls, finishing with 6 to Nigeria’s 16. Canada, No. 7 in the FIFA Women’s Rankings, is led by 40-year-old F Christine Sinclair, who had 323 caps and 190 goals as of April 11 of this year.

Ireland, No. 22 in the FIFA rankings, suffered a heart-breaking 1-0 loss to host Australia to kick off its group stage action. Ireland had 4 fewer shots and 1 fewer shot on target. It had just 37% of the possession. The only goal scored was a penalty, so Ireland’s defense held up well.

2023 Women’s World Cup: Switzerland vs. Norway odds, picks and predictions

Analyzing Tuesday’s Switzerland vs. Norway odds and lines, with Women’s World Cup soccer expert picks, predictions and best bets.

Norway (0-0-1 / W-D-L) battles Switzerland (1-0-0) Tuesday in a Group A stage match of the 2023 Women’s World Cup. Kickoff from FMG Stadium Waikato in Hamilton, New Zealand, is set for 4 a.m. ET (FS1). Below, we analyze BetMGM Sportsbook’s lines around the Switzerland vs. Norway odds, and make our best Women’s World Cup bets, picks and predictions.

Norway suffered a stunning 1-0 loss Thursday to kick off the event, falling to New Zealand, which benefited a bit with a home-field advantage. Norway outshot New Zealand 13-12 — both with 2 shots on target — but had 3 times as many fouls (15 to 5). Norway does have one of the best rosters in the world, led by F Ada Hegerberg, winner of the Women’s Ballon d’Or in 2018.

Switzerland opened its Cup action with a 2-0 victory over the Philippines 2-0 Friday. The Swiss had 17 shots and 8 on target, controlling possession 74% of the time. The Philippines had 3 shots and 0 on target. MF Seraina Piubel scored the lone non-penalty goal for the Swiss.

Norway ranks 12th in the FIFA Women’s Rankings; Switzerland is 20th.

2023 Women’s World Cup: New Zealand vs. Philippines odds, picks and predictions

Analyzing Tuesday’s New Zealand vs. Philippines odds and lines, with Women’s World Cup soccer expert picks, predictions and best bets.

In a Group A matchup, New Zealand (1-0-0 / W-D-L) and Philippines (0-0-1) meet Tuesday in the 2023 Women’s World Cup at Westpac Stadium in Wellington, New Zealand. Kickoff is scheduled for 1:30 a.m. ET (FS1). Below, we analyze BetMGM Sportsbook’s lines around the New Zealand vs. Philippines odds, and make our best Women’s World Cup bets, picks and predictions.

New Zealand opened Group A play with its 1st-ever Women’s World Cup victory, toppling heavily-favored Norway by a 1-0 count. F Hannah Wilkinson banged in a goal early in the 2nd half for the difference-maker for the Football Ferns.

New Zealand cashed as the underdog while Under 2.5 goals easily cashed. The Under also cashed in the opening group match for Philippines.

The underdog Philippines was tripped up 2-0 against Switzerland on Friday. It was the 1st-ever World Cup appearance for the Pacific Island nation, 1 of 8 countries making their tournament debuts this year. Philippines dropped a 2-1 international friendly against New Zealand back in September.

2023 Women’s World Cup: Colombia vs. South Korea odds, picks and predictions

Analyzing Monday’s Colombia vs. South Korea odds and lines, with Women’s World Cup soccer expert picks, predictions and best bets.

In the Group H opener for both nations, Colombia and South Korea meet Monday at Sydney Football Stadium in the 2023 Women’s World Cup. Kickoff is scheduled for 10 p.m. ET (FS1). Below, we analyze BetMGM Sportsbook’s lines around the Colombia vs. South Korea odds, and make our best Women’s World Cup bets, picks and predictions.

Colombia, runners-up at the Copa America tournament in 2022, kicks off its 3rd-ever World Cup appearance. The team is led by captain Daniela Montoya, while 18-year-old phenom Linda Caicedo will also figure in prominently.

South Korea will be making its 4th-ever World Cup appearance. It reached the final in the Women’s Asian Cup in 2022, but it is looking to make history in this tournament. It has won just 1 previous match in its previous 10 FIFA Women’s World Cup matches. South Korea has also never had a clean sheet in the World Cup, while failing to score a goal in each of the previous 3 opening matches.

2023 Women’s World Cup: Germany vs. Morocco odds, picks and predictions

Analyzing Monday’s Germany vs. Morocco odds and lines, with Women’s World Cup soccer expert picks, predictions and best bets.

Germany battles Morocco on Monday in the first Women’s World Cup action for both nations. Kickoff in the Group H battle from Melbourne Rectangular Stadium is set for 4:30 a.m. ET (FS1). Below, we analyze BetMGM Sportsbook’s lines around the Germany vs. Morocco odds, and make our best Women’s World Cup bets, picks and predictions.

Germany earned a bid for the World Cup by winning Group H in UEFA qualification last September. Since then Germany has played 9 matches, winning 5, losing 3 and drawing 1. It beat USA 2-1 in a friendly on Nov. 10. Germany is led by F Alexandra Popp, who has 128 caps and 62 international goals.

Morocco qualified by being the quarterfinal winner of the 2022 Women’s Africa Cup of Nations. In 2023, it has posted a 2-3-2 record. It does have draws against Italy and Switzerland, both of which are top-20 nations. F Ghizlane Chebbak is the most notable player. She captains the team and has had 61 caps and 21 international goals.

Germany is 2nd in the FIFA Women’s World Rankings and Morocco is 72nd.
